Automated Regulatory Compliance Documentation for Life Sciences Consulting

Life Sciences clients face stringent FDA and international regulatory requirements. Manual documentation is prone to human error and consumes high-value consultant time. For a national operator like RCM Technologies, automating the generation and validation of compliance artifacts ensures consistency and reduces overhead. This allows senior consultants to focus on high-level strategy rather than repetitive administrative tasks, directly improving margins in a high-stakes industry segment where precision is non-negotiable.

Up to 40% reduction in documentation timeLife Sciences Regulatory Tech Benchmarks
An AI agent integrated with document management systems that ingests project requirements, cross-references internal compliance templates, and drafts validation protocols. It monitors regulatory updates in real-time to flag potential non-compliance risks in project documentation before submission.

Intelligent HCM Vendor Integration and Data Mapping

Managing HCM implementations involves complex data mapping across disparate legacy systems. Consultants often spend significant time on manual data cleansing and reconciliation. AI agents can streamline these workflows by identifying patterns in data structures and automating the mapping process. This reduces the risk of project delays and ensures that clients receive faster, more accurate system deployments, enhancing RCM's reputation for technical expertise and adaptability in the competitive HCM consulting market.

20-30% faster system integration cyclesHCM Consulting Industry Performance Metrics
An agent that analyzes source data schemas from legacy HCM systems and automatically generates transformation scripts for target vendor platforms. It performs automated data validation checks to identify anomalies, significantly reducing manual reconciliation efforts during the implementation lifecycle.

Predictive Managed Services Ticket Resolution and Triage

Managed services providers must balance rapid response with cost control. High volumes of routine tickets can overwhelm support teams. AI agents can triage incoming requests, resolve common issues, and escalate complex problems to the appropriate expert, ensuring optimal resource allocation. This improves client satisfaction through faster resolution times while allowing RCM to scale its managed services operations without a linear increase in headcount, protecting margins in a price-sensitive market.

35% improvement in first-contact resolutionGlobal IT Managed Services Standards
An agent that monitors incoming support tickets, categorizing them by complexity and priority. It utilizes a knowledge base of previous resolutions to provide automated responses for common technical issues and routes high-priority escalations to specific consultants based on their real-time availability and expertise.

Automated IT Strategy Assessment and Gap Analysis

Consulting engagements often begin with time-intensive IT assessments. Automating the initial data collection and gap analysis phases allows RCM to provide immediate value to clients. By using AI to benchmark client IT environments against industry best practices, RCM can deliver more comprehensive and data-backed strategic recommendations faster. This positions RCM as a forward-thinking partner and increases the efficiency of the initial assessment phase, which is often a bottleneck in the sales-to-delivery transition.

25% reduction in initial assessment timeIT Consulting Operational Efficiency Report
An agent that ingests client IT infrastructure data and security logs, comparing them against industry-standard frameworks like NIST or ISO. It generates a preliminary gap analysis report, highlighting areas for improvement and potential risks, which consultants then refine for final client presentation.

How does RCM ensure the accuracy of AI-generated outputs?
Accuracy is managed through a 'human-in-the-loop' architecture. AI agents provide drafts, recommendations, or structured data, which are then reviewed and validated by subject matter experts before being shared with clients. We also implement confidence scoring mechanisms that flag outputs for manual review if the agent's certainty falls below a pre-defined threshold, maintaining the high standards expected of RCM.
